WebJun 14, 2024 · Crackers and cheese. This is a great way to get both protein and fiber. Eat a few slices of cheese with some nice whole-grain crackers, which come in a variety of textures and flavors. Nuts and/or seeds. A bag full of nuts and/or seeds is always handy to have around and it doesn't require preparation or refrigeration. WebMorning sickness is very common. Most pregnant women have at least some nausea, and about one third have vomiting. Morning sickness most often begins during the first month of pregnancy and continues through the 14th to 16th week (3rd or 4th month). Some women have nausea and vomiting through their entire pregnancy.
